Studios coordinator

WHO: artists, arts professionals

WHAT: Principal purpose is to support all aspects of Studio Holder activity within the building, to maintain the studios and related facilities and to manage and administrate the S1 Associates Scheme. To put in place strategies to allow Studio Holders and Associates the opportunity to develop their artistic practice and networks. To raise the profile of Studio Holders and Associates, S1 Artspace and its facilities.

WHEN: 2 days per week: Normally 10.30 - 6.30pm, but flexibility required

PAYMENTS: £18,000 pro rata

DETAILS: Key responsibilities include To effectively manage all aspects of the studios including all administration, finance, fundraising and marketing activities. To manage and administrate the S1 Associates Scheme. To promote Studio Holder and Associates activity to a wide and diverse audience. To develop fundraising bids to improve access to the building, general facilities, necessary renovations and to continue the Studio Coordinators position. To ensure that all forms of communication are maintained and kept up to date, including the Studios and Associates pages on the website, Facebook, Twitter etc. To research potential opportunities for S1’s Studio Holders and Associates To co-ordinate the studio holders’ review process. To co-ordinate all internal communications between studio holders, staff and the Board. To work with the Technician and Studio Holders to effectively maintain the function and cleanliness of all aspects of the building and its facilities. Provide day-to-day maintenance to the building and to undertake cleaning duties as required. To represent Studios Holders at Board meetings and external events when necessary To actively and positively contribute to other areas of S1 Artspace’s activities and duties as and when required
